The museum where I volunteer has a large artillery shell casing - German WW2. The mouth of the casing is 22.5 to 22.8 cm (ie - slightly squished) and the rim diameter is 25.7 cm. Length is 85 cm. There are no painted markings but the base has stamped "1 VII 30095", "Aux 41", "[swastika] w a A 700", "S17".
Based on the above, I guess it is a 220-mm casing - possibly German production for the French or Skoda 220-mm guns/howitzers, but I cannot find if they used casings or BL charges.
